mobile menu
mobile menu
About
FAQ
Home
Specialties
Tulsa, OK, 74104
Salah Uddin MD
Salah Uddin MD
2000 S WHEELING AVE STE 510
Tulsa, OK, 74104
(918) 747-5200
Physician
Profile
Salah Uddin. His primary practice is as an Internal Medicine: Nephrology.